Vessel Description

SVITZER DENISE is an ASD (Azimuth Stern Drive) harbour tug operating under the Brazilian flag as part of the Svitzer Brasil fleet. Built in 2017 by Uzmar Shipyard in Turkey, the vessel is designed for port towage, ship-handling, and escort operations. As an ASD tug, she benefits from twin azimuthing thrusters providing exceptional manoeuvrability and a high bollard pull capacity, making her well suited for assisting large vessels in confined port environments. The vessel forms part of Svitzer's South American operational portfolio, which provides towage services to major Brazilian ports and terminals.
